Here's a breakdown of how Lou Holtz, Steve Spurrier,
Will Muschamp, and Shane Beamer performed in their
first five seasons as head football coaches at South
Carolina, focusing on overall record, SEC record,
and results against Clemson
South Carolina Football Coaches: First 5-Year Performance
Record
Coach Years Overall Win % SEC Win % vs Clemson
Lou Holtz 1999–2003 31–38 44.9% 15–25 37.5% 1–4
Steve Spurrier 2005–2009 35–22 61.4% 18–22 45.0% 1–4
Will Muschamp 2016–2020 28–30 48.3% 17–23 42.5% 1–4
Shane Beamer 2021–2025 32–24 57.1% 16–19 45.7% 2–2
Key Takeaways
Best Overall Record: Spurrier had the strongest
overall start (35–22), though Beamer is close behind
in win percentage.
SEC Performance:
Beamer leads in win percentage in conference play.
but Spurrier leads in SEC wins.
Clemson Rivalry: Beamer is the only one with a
non-losing record against Clemson in his first five
years, going 2–2.
